Description:
When parsing a complex type that is set to have mixed content, and there is no particle defined, JaxMeXS assumes the content is empty instead of mixed.

I uncovered this when I was testing JaxMe XS against the Microsoft test in the XML Schema Test Collection in the file /msxsdtest/attributeGroup/attgD005.xsd. I will attach it to this bug for reference, together with a patch that will fix it.
